**Later Life Lending:** Advisers should consider housing wealth as part of the financial toolkit for older clients. Dave Harris, CEO at more2life, suggests that the biggest opportunity in later life lending is often overlooked because housing wealth is not part of the financial discussion.
This disconnect highlights the need to address any housing wealth 'blind spot', and to improve outcomes for older borrowers.
